Hago—short for "Have A Good One"—is an all-in-one Android and iOS application that blends casual mobile gaming with deep social features. Unlike standard standalone mobile games, Hago functions as a social playground where users from across the globe can connect through real-time audio chat while playing an expansive library of over 100 mini-games.
